Professional Attorney Headshots: First Impressions Are Important

Professional headshots of lawyers are quite important for making good first impressions. These close-up pictures of the lawyer’s face show that they are confident, trustworthy, and easy to talk to. Law firm websites, LinkedIn profiles, speaking engagements, and media appearances all use headshots a lot. A well-done headshot can set a lawyer apart from others and give them a sense of trustworthiness. A good headshot should have the right clothes, the right lighting, and a neutral or professional background. Lawyers commonly use headshots in marketing materials and presentations, so it’s crucial that they look the same on all platforms. Professional photographers that specialize in legal pictures know how to get the small expressions that show expertise and trust. Steps and Requirements for Getting a License to Practice Law

To become a qualified lawyer, you have to go through a set process that includes schooling, tests, and moral qualities. The first step is to get a bachelor’s degree. The next step is to get a Juris Doctor (JD) from a law school that is recognized. After they graduate, candidates must pass the bar exam in their state to get their license. The Multistate Professional Responsibility Examination (MPRE) is another test that certain places need. It tests your understanding of professional ethics. As part of the licensing procedure, people also have to go through background checks and character evaluations. Attorneys must keep their licenses up to date by taking continuing legal education classes after they get their licenses.
